There are 3 ways to get from Harrogate to Caernarfon by train or car
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Train
best- Take the train from Leeds to Newton-le-Willowstrain Newcastle - Liverpool Lime Street / ...
- Take the train from Newton-le-Willows to Bangor (Gwynedd)train Manchester Airport - Holyhead
5h 44m£48–151Drive 155.3 mi
cheapest- Drive from Harrogate to Caernarfoncar 155.3 mi
3h£38–55Train via Chester
- Take the train from Leeds to Chestertrain Leeds - Chester
- Take the train from Chester to Bangor (Gwynedd)train Manchester Airport - Holyhead / ...
6h 5m£41–161
Harrogate to Caernarfon by train and bus
Questions & Answers
The cheapest way to get from Harrogate to Caernarfon is to drive which costs £35 - £55 and takes 3h.
The fastest way to get from Harrogate to Caernarfon is to drive which takes 3h and costs £35 - £55.
The distance between Harrogate and Caernarfon is 170 miles. The road distance is 156.2 miles.
The best way to get from Harrogate to Caernarfon without a car is to train which takes 5h 44m and costs £45 - £160.
It takes approximately 5h 44m to get from Harrogate to Caernarfon, including transfers.
Yes, the driving distance between Harrogate to Caernarfon is 156 miles. It takes approximately 3h to drive from Harrogate to Caernarfon.
There are 1722+ hotels available in Caernarfon.
What companies run services between Harrogate, England and Caernarfon, Wales?
You can take a train from Harrogate to Caernarfon Bus Station Stand A via Leeds, Newton-le-Willows, Bangor (Gwynedd), and Bangor Railway Station H in around 5h 44m.
- Phone
- +44 345 600 1671
- tpecustomer.relations@tpexpress.co.uk
- Website
- tpexpress.co.uk
Train from Leeds to Newton-le-Willows
- Ave. Duration
- 1h 9m
- Frequency
- Hourly
- Estimated price
- £14–40
- Website
- https://www.tpexpress.co.uk/
- Standard
- £14–21
- 1st Class
- £30–40
- Phone
- +44 800 200 6060
- enquiries@northernrailway.co.uk
- Website
- northernrailway.co.uk
Train from Leeds to Newton-le-Willows
- Ave. Duration
- 1h 44m
- Frequency
- Hourly
- Estimated price
- £10–13
- Website
- https://www.northernrailway.co.uk/
- Standard
- £10–13
Train from Leeds to Chester
- Ave. Duration
- 2h 19m
- Frequency
- Hourly
- Estimated price
- £11–15
- Website
- https://www.northernrailway.co.uk/
- Standard
- £11–15
- Phone
- 03333 211 202
- Website
- tfw.wales
Train from Newton-le-Willows to Bangor (Gwynedd)
- Ave. Duration
- 2h 2m
- Frequency
- Hourly
- Estimated price
- £30–50
- Website
- https://tfw.wales/
- Anytime Day Single
- £30–50
Train from Chester to Bangor (Gwynedd)
- Ave. Duration
- 1h 14m
- Frequency
- Hourly
- Estimated price
- £23–35
- Website
- https://tfw.wales/
- Anytime Day Single
- £23–35
- Phone
- +44 345 528 0253
- Website
- avantiwestcoast.co.uk
Train from Chester to Bangor (Gwynedd)
- Ave. Duration
- 1h 8m
- Frequency
- Every 4 hours
- Estimated price
- £22–85
- Website
- https://www.avantiwestcoast.co.uk/
- Anytime Single
- £22–35
- Anytime Single 1st Class
- £55–85
Want to know more about travelling around United Kingdom
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.
Related travel guides
Travelling to the UK: What do I need to know?
Read the travel guide





















